There's just one game in the books for this season's Stanley Cup Final, but Vegas has already pegged the favorites for the 2023 NHL championship.

sportsbetting-baseball-2022.png

To probably no one's surprise, the Avalanche and Lightning sit atop the board, with 6-1 and 8-1 odds, respectively.

The Hurricanes and Rangers are tied for the third-best odds at 10-1, and Edmonton rounds out the Top 5 at 11-1.
